What was your first cosplay?
The first cosplay I made was a “Vigilante Spider-Man” from The Amazing Spider-Man film. It was a pretty simple suit and a great way to get inside the cosplay community. (I had already gone to conventions before the film but as a civilian only)
Do you make your own cosplay costumes, if so, which ones, and how long does an average costume take to make?
It’s a group collaboration of some sorts. There are pieces of my cosplays that I buy and others I make. However, the 3D rubber-like webbing and brick patterns are done by hand by myself (Using 3D fabric paint) I also sew my suits. Time is relative but can take up to months in some occasions.

Have you ever made any mistakes that you’d warn a first timer about?
Bring hot glue to the conventions. (EXTREMELY essential for any cosplay) Also, have a game plan and take breaks. It may be cool to have a lot of people asking for photos but you are human and require some rest. You may need icy-hot gel (or something similar) the day after the convention.
